Output 59d12061b33dd601a0f604e70a2ab6d0b65a55dc5c90e175be2a9ef60e8a42a2:0

value
1578578479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75105fece1a40a03a82401bca6e6d7009cd549fb OP_EQUAL
address
MJa8ucH1WFUpvLesb65fHGFHoNcrC7hsAR
transaction
59d12061b33dd601a0f604e70a2ab6d0b65a55dc5c90e175be2a9ef60e8a42a2
spent
true